/**
* SECTION:gstmessage
* @short_description: Lightweight objects to signal the application of
* pipeline events
* @see_also: #GstBus,#GstMiniObject
*
* Messages are implemented as a subclass of #GstMiniObject with a generic
* #GstStructure as the content. This allows for writing custom messages without
* requiring an API change while allowing a wide range of different types
* of messages.
*
* Messages are posted by objects in the pipeline and are passed to the
* application using the #GstBus.
*/

/**
* gst_message_new_custom:
* @type: The #GstMessageType to distinguish messages
* @src: The object originating the message.
* @structure: The structure for the message. The message will take ownership of
* the structure.
*
* Create a new custom-typed message. This can be used for anything not
* handled by other message-specific functions to pass a message to the
* app. The structure field can be NULL.
*
* Returns: The new message.
*
* MT safe.
*/
GstMessage *
gst_message_new_custom (GstMessageType type, GstObject * src,
GstStructure * structure)
{
GstMessage *message;
message = (GstMessage *) gst_mini_object_new (GST_TYPE_MESSAGE);
GST_CAT_LOG (GST_CAT_MESSAGE, "creating new message %p %s", message,
gst_message_type_get_name (type));
message->type = type;
if (src) {
message->src = gst_object_ref (src);
GST_CAT_DEBUG_OBJECT (GST_CAT_MESSAGE, src, "message source");
} else {
message->src = NULL;
GST_CAT_DEBUG (GST_CAT_MESSAGE, "NULL message source");
}
if (structure) {
gst_structure_set_parent_refcount (structure,
&message->mini_object.refcount);
}
message->structure = structure;
return message;
}
/**
* gst_message_new_eos:
* @src: The object originating the message.
*
* Create a new eos message. This message is generated and posted in
* the sink elements of a GstBin. The bin will only forward the EOS
* message to the application if all sinks have posted an EOS message.
*
* Returns: The new eos message.
*
* MT safe.
*/
GstMessage *
gst_message_new_eos (GstObject * src)
{
GstMessage *message;
message = gst_message_new_custom (GST_MESSAGE_EOS, src, NULL);
return message;
}

/**
* gst_message_new_state_dirty:
* @src: the object originating the message
*
* Create a state dirty message. This message is posted whenever an element
* changed its state asynchronously and is used internally to update the
* states of container objects.
*
* Returns: The new state dirty message.
*
* MT safe.
*/
GstMessage *
gst_message_new_state_dirty (GstObject * src)
{
GstMessage *message;
message = gst_message_new_custom (GST_MESSAGE_STATE_DIRTY, src, NULL);
return message;
}
/**
* gst_message_new_clock_provide:
* @src: The object originating the message.
* @clock: The clock it provides
* @ready: TRUE if the sender can provide a clock
*
* Create a clock provide message. This message is posted whenever an
* element is ready to provide a clock or lost its ability to provide
* a clock (maybe because it paused or became EOS).
*
* This message is mainly used internally to manage the clock
* selection.
*
* Returns: The new provide clock message.
*
* MT safe.
*/
GstMessage *
gst_message_new_clock_provide (GstObject * src, GstClock * clock,
gboolean ready)
{
GstMessage *message;
message = gst_message_new_custom (GST_MESSAGE_CLOCK_PROVIDE, src,
gst_structure_new ("GstMessageClockProvide",
"clock", GST_TYPE_CLOCK, clock,
"ready", G_TYPE_BOOLEAN, ready, NULL));
return message;
}
/**
* gst_message_new_clock_lost:
* @src: The object originating the message.
* @clock: the clock that was lost
*
* Create a clock lost message. This message is posted whenever the
* clock is not valid anymore.
*
* If this message is posted by the pipeline, the pipeline will
* select a new clock again when it goes to PLAYING. It might therefore
* be needed to set the pipeline to PAUSED and PLAYING again.
*
* Returns: The new clock lost message.
*
* MT safe.
*/
GstMessage *
gst_message_new_clock_lost (GstObject * src, GstClock * clock)
{
GstMessage *message;
message = gst_message_new_custom (GST_MESSAGE_CLOCK_LOST, src,
gst_structure_new ("GstMessageClockLost",
"clock", GST_TYPE_CLOCK, clock, NULL));
return message;
}

/**
* gst_message_new_segment_start:
* @src: The object originating the message.
* @format: The format of the position being played
* @position: The position of the segment being played
*
* Create a new segment message. This message is posted by elements that
* start playback of a segment as a result of a segment seek. This message
* is not received by the application but is used for maintenance reasons in
* container elements.
*
* Returns: The new segment start message.
*
* MT safe.
*/
GstMessage *
gst_message_new_segment_start (GstObject * src, GstFormat format,
gint64 position)
{
GstMessage *message;
message = gst_message_new_custom (GST_MESSAGE_SEGMENT_START, src,
gst_structure_new ("GstMessageSegmentStart",
"format", GST_TYPE_FORMAT, format,
"position", G_TYPE_INT64, position, NULL));
return message;
}
/**
* gst_message_new_segment_done:
* @src: The object originating the message.
* @format: The format of the position being done
* @position: The position of the segment being done
*
* Create a new segment done message. This message is posted by elements that
* finish playback of a segment as a result of a segment seek. This message
* is received by the application after all elements that posted a segment_start
* have posted the segment_done.
*
* Returns: The new segment done message.
*
* MT safe.
*/
GstMessage *
gst_message_new_segment_done (GstObject * src, GstFormat format,
gint64 position)
{
GstMessage *message;
message = gst_message_new_custom (GST_MESSAGE_SEGMENT_DONE, src,
gst_structure_new ("GstMessageSegmentDone",
"format", GST_TYPE_FORMAT, format,
"position", G_TYPE_INT64, position, NULL));
return message;
}

/**
* gst_message_new_element:
* @src: The object originating the message.
* @structure: The structure for the message. The message will take ownership of
* the structure.
*
* Create a new element-specific message. This is meant as a generic way of
* allowing one-way communication from an element to an application, for example
* "the firewire cable was unplugged". The format of the message should be
* documented in the element's documentation. The structure field can be NULL.
*
* Returns: The new element message.
*
* MT safe.
*/
GstMessage *
gst_message_new_element (GstObject * src, GstStructure * structure)
{
return gst_message_new_custom (GST_MESSAGE_ELEMENT, src, structure);
}
/**
* gst_message_new_duration:
* @src: The object originating the message.
* @format: The format of the duration
* @duration: The new duration
*
* Create a new duration message. This message is posted by elements that
* know the duration of a stream in a specific format. This message
* is received by bins and is used to calculate the total duration of a
* pipeline.
*
* Returns: The new duration message.
*
* MT safe.
*/
GstMessage *
gst_message_new_duration (GstObject * src, GstFormat format, gint64 duration)
{
GstMessage *message;
message = gst_message_new_custom (GST_MESSAGE_DURATION, src,
gst_structure_new ("GstMessageDuration",
"format", GST_TYPE_FORMAT, format,
"duration", G_TYPE_INT64, duration, NULL));
return message;
}
